Mazda-3D-Black.pngCost of Replacement Car Key

The cost of a replacement car key can vary greatly in accordance with the type of key used and the vehicle. This article will discuss the three factors that affect the cost.

Dealerships charge more than independent locksmiths or other third-party service providers for remotes and key fobs. This is because car dealerships take advantage of their convenience and popularity.

The kind of key

The type of key you have plays a major role in how much it costs to replace it. Keys that are basic, replacement Car key cost without transponder chips remote, laser cut key are the most affordable option, but more sophisticated models are significantly more expensive. Key fobs that are integrated into smart keys require specialized programming and machinery only available through dealerships.

Some keys are also harder to duplicate. For example, a laser cut key is designed to avoid duplicates by using distinct patterns in the key blade. This makes it harder for a person with a grinder or a laser cutter to create duplicates.

The type of vehicle

The type of vehicle you drive will determine the cost of a replacement key. This is because different vehicles have different kinds of keys and some are more costly to replace than others. If your car is equipped with an electronic key, for example, it will be more expensive to replace than if you are using a basic metal key. You can find out the make and model of your vehicle by looking up the VIN number. You'll then know what type of key you require.

Modern cars typically require more complex keys, which utilize transponder chips and remote parts. These keys are more difficult to duplicate than earlier models, which is the reason they are more expensive.

Some of these types of keys are only re-usable by a dealer or locksmith, so it is important to look into your options thoroughly. If you have an old key fob that is not very complex, it could be less expensive to replace it by a locksmith instead of an individual dealer.

However, if you own an intelligent key that comes with an integrated transponder, you'll need to shell out more money to replace it. These are more expensive than standard key fobs and require special equipment to cut them. The key itself costs more to manufacture due to the added technology, but you will also need a technician to program it.

The technology

The loss of car keys can be a stressful experience, especially if it happens in a remote location. It's also expensive to replace them and many drivers don't have extra money lying around. Modern car key technology makes the process easier and cheaper.

The first step is to get an alternative key. There are a variety of options to choose from and the price will vary depending on the kind of key you've got. Basic metal keys, for example, are the least expensive, whereas fobs are more costly. For a quote on a new key you can contact local dealers, locksmiths or mechanics.

Modern car keys come with a computer chip built in that communicates with the car's system. This reduces the risk of theft and provides a higher level of security. However, it's still possible for someone to make an unauthentic key. The best way to protect yourself is to buy an extended warranty for your car.

In the past, replacing keys lost required a trip to the dealer. The dealer would use a special machine to cut the key, then connect it to a computer which electronically "paired it" with your vehicle. Locksmiths are now able to do the same job at only a fraction of the cost. They can utilize a device called an EZ Installer that connects to the standard diagnostic port of your auto car key replacement near me and connects your keys to the vehicle's system.

The location

In the past, misplacing or even losing your car key was a minor inconvenience. It was possible to replace it in a few minutes at your local hardware store or locksmith for a reasonable cost. As cars have become more complex and technologically advanced, their keys have also evolved into complex electronic devices that could be costly to replace. This is why it's important to have a spare key available and keep it in a safe place, to avoid the headache and expense of having your Replacement Car Key Cost (Janggun4.Dgweb.Kr) car key.

The kind of key you have will determine the cost to have it replaced. If you have a traditional mechanical key, a transponder key or a smart one will determine how much it costs to have it duplicated. A traditional key is cheapest. A smart key or transponder key is more expensive. Additionally, some types of keys can only be replaced by a dealership, while other types can be made by a locksmith or a mechanic.

The location of the key can also affect the cost. If you lose your keys in a remote location, it may take longer to have it replaced than the case if you lost it within the city. This is due to the tow truck or the locksmith will need to travel further to reach you. In addition, the cost of replacing a key could increase when the weather is bad.

If you lose your car keys it's a good idea to call your insurance company as quickly as possible. The majority of companies will cover at least a part of the cost, depending on the coverage and terms of your policy. Often the cost of the new key is covered by a roadside assistance add-on or a longer bumper-to-bumper warranty, so be sure to check your coverage to ensure that you don't have to pay for the cost.
